High-power quartz plasmadynamic source of short-wavelength and vacuum ultraviolet radiation with a brightness temperature ~40 kK

A. S. Kamrukov, G. N. Kashnikov, N. P. Kozlov, S. G. Kuznetsov, A. G. Opekan, V. K. Orlov, Yu. S. Protasov, A. N. Yakimenko
Abstract: An analysis of possible ways of enhancing the brightness of ultraviolet radiation emitted by quartz light sources led to a proposal of a new lamp in which an electric-discharge plasma is heated as a result of shock-wave thermalization of directional kinetic energy when a high-velocity plasma stream is decelerated in a gaseous medium, which also acts as a filter of the hard component of the plasma emission spectrum. This approach made it possible to construct quartz light sources characterized by an output radiation flux density in the short-wavelength ultraviolet range (180–250 nm) corresponding to the radiation emitted by a black body at a temperature of 40 kK.
